    Russian Man Sentenced After Barron Trump Reports Assault in UK

    A British court sentenced a Russian national to four years in prison on Friday following an assault incident reported by Barron Trump, the youngest son of former U.S. President Donald Trump. The 20-year-old Barron observed the attack on a woman friend during a video call from the United States and promptly alerted UK authorities.

    The victim, residing in London, was contacted by Barron in January of the previous year. During the call, he witnessed the assault and immediately informed the police. The accused, 22-year-old Matvei Rumiantsev, had been in an on-and-off relationship with the woman for several months.

    Judge Joel Bennathan, presiding over the case at Snaresbrook Crown Court, highlighted the role Barron played in ensuring emergency services were contacted despite being overseas. The judge noted that Rumiantsev not only assaulted the woman but also filmed her during the attack, an act intended to humiliate her.

    The victim sustained multiple injuries, including bruises on her chin, arm, and wrist, scratches, and hair loss. She also made emergency calls during the assault. Rumiantsev was convicted in January of assault and perverting the course of justice but was acquitted of charges related to rape and intentional strangulation. He received two consecutive two-year prison sentences for the offenses he was found guilty of.
